Output 663de01de7f82ffc89bb140ae6343c8f97d97319e3b192801efb8534b78ef911:0

value
45645
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fae495a6e76e3fbda223718af2e8fac3b6429c80 OP_EQUALVERIFY OP_CHECKSIG
address
1PsbmHy3HNH1DDZZAstpGYvo2vf3vDojVb
transaction
663de01de7f82ffc89bb140ae6343c8f97d97319e3b192801efb8534b78ef911
confirmations
491419
spent
true